[0033] Example 1: Select agarwood trees with a 3-year-old tree with a diameter at breast height ≥4cm, and drill holes from top to bottom at a 45-degree angle to the trunk with a wood drill. The diameter of the drill bit is 0.5cm, and the hole depth is better than 1 / 2 of the diameter of the tree. . Respectively apply the solution that can induce the production of agarwood (abbreviated as agarwood induction liquid, such as chemical solution, microbial cells, or microbial cell components or metabolites) through the borehole tree infusion to apply high-efficiency agarwood inducers (after application The rubber stopper seals the hole to prevent the agarwood inducer from flowing out and rain washing), and reapply it one or more times every 3 months. [0034] Example 2: Using an infusion device to induce damage to agarwood trees and 6 months later, the whole tree was felled, the resin-containing wood was cut, the resin-free part was removed, and the agarwood production was measured. Agarwood oil was prepared with reference to the method for determination of extracts in Appendix XA of the Chinese Pharmacopoeia (2010 Edition), and the alcohol-soluble extract content of the obtained agarwood samples was determined. Crush the sample, pass through a No. 2 sieve, and mix well. Take about 2g of the sample to be tested, put it in a 250ml conical flask, add 50ml of 95% ethanol, stopper tightly, weigh it, let it stand for 1h, connect the reflux condenser, heat it to a slight boiling, and keep it boiling for 1h After letting cool, remove the Erlenmeyer flask, tightly stopper, weigh it, make up the lost weight with ethanol, shake well, and filter with a dry filter.
